antd是一个流行的前端UI框架,它提供了丰富的组件和样式,方便开发人员快速构建美观、响应式的Web应用程序。antd的可移植程序指的是可以在不同的语言环境下使用antd框架进行开发的程序。
然而,antd的可移植程序默认情况下可能无法直接更改语言为英语。antd框架本身并没有提供直接更改语言的功能,但可以通过引入antd的国际化组件来实现语言切换的功能。
antd的国际化组件是antd提供的一种机制,用于支持多语言环境下的开发。通过使用antd的国际化组件,开发人员可以将应用程序的界面文本翻译成不同的语言,包括英语。
在antd中,可以使用LocaleProvider
组件来实现国际化功能。通过在应用程序中引入LocaleProvider
组件,并设置语言为英语,就可以将antd的可移植程序的语言更改为英语。
以下是一个示例代码,展示了如何在antd的可移植程序中将语言更改为英语:
import React from 'react';
import { LocaleProvider } from 'antd';
import enUS from 'antd/lib/locale-provider/en_US';
import YourApp from './YourApp';
const App = () => (
<LocaleProvider locale={enUS}>
<YourApp />
</LocaleProvider>
);
export default App;
在上述示例代码中,我们首先引入了LocaleProvider
组件和英语语言包enUS
。然后,在LocaleProvider
组件中设置语言为英语,将YourApp
组件包裹在LocaleProvider
组件中。
通过以上步骤,我们就可以将antd的可移植程序的语言更改为英语。
推荐的腾讯云相关产品:腾讯云服务器(CVM)和腾讯云对象存储(COS)。
以上是关于antd可移植程序无法将语言更改为英语的完善且全面的答案。希望对您有帮助!
领取专属 10元无门槛券
手把手带您无忧上云